Output 6023cbbc3838f3b187ff58da2b45afa998fe8957a64aae0c0690b2fb69d47f21:0

value
85363197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de066643ec1a9b3315c60d16b3b9e1f1e75c462e OP_EQUAL
address
3MvybmooRMkUmZNxxN3PkoCoJr9832LGWz
transaction
6023cbbc3838f3b187ff58da2b45afa998fe8957a64aae0c0690b2fb69d47f21
spent
true